Newcomer Halsey adds another London show after selling out Islington Academy in seconds
Is it Lana Del Rey? Is it Lorde? No, it's upcoming New Yorker Halsey, storming the world with her alternative pop, and selling out venues in seconds.
The atmospheric beats and catchy lyrics are a taste of what the upcoming Halsey has to offer. Having reached millions of views across her videos, it's no doubt her sound is sought after.
The subtle alternative-pop must be a crowd pleaser considering she sold out Islington Academy in seconds. But do not fear, Halsey fans, as she has added an extra London date at Koko on 11 September. The 20-year-old musician has also just reached number two on the US album charts with her debut album Badlands, which isn't even out until 28 August.
